Kikilia-Karamanlis meeting on the Ukrainian crisis and the preparation of the tourist season

The Minister of Tourism Vassilis Kikilias and the Minister of Infrastructure and Transport Costas Karamanlis made a first assessment of the effects of the Ukrainian crisis in their areas of responsibility, during a working meeting held at the Ministry of Tourism. In their statements after the meeting, Messrs. Kikilias and Karamanlis also referred to the close cooperation of the two ministries for the thorough preparation of the upcoming tourist season.

The Minister of Tourism Vassilis Kikilias stressed that during the meeting a first assessment was made of the crisis that has arisen after the dramatic developments in Ukraine and how it affects our areas of responsibility. “We work together for the preparation, which takes place from the winter months, for the maximum possible achievement of our goals in what has to do with the tourism product, which is the locomotive of the Greek economy and of course goes through the air and road interconnections “, he stated characteristically.

For his part, the Minister of Infrastructure and Transport stated that he agreed with the Minister of Tourism to be in constant contact, in order to deal with any problems that may arise. “And secondly, because prevention is better than cure, we must be ready for the tourist season,” he said.

Mr. Karamanlis stated that “it is very important that the airports and our entire air navigation system are ready to accept, we want to hope, a record year for Greek tourism”, as he said and added that the Ministries of Transport and the Service Civil Aviation must be prepared to deal with any issues that arise over a summer period.
